Could have been a regression introduced by my refactoring the handling
of block-containers between 0.94 and 0.95beta. The case wasn't covered
in our test suite. I've committed a fix to the 0.95 branch:

The problem was that the flow area didn't generate a real reference area
(i.e. a new coordinate system).

Please note that the width="100%" will still (i.e. like in 0.94) return
a value that may not exactly be what you need for such a column
separator. I don't think there's any construct in XSL-FO that allows you
to express that properly. FO-Implementations like AntennaHouse have
proprietary extension for that.

> > For the first block of text, the overlap is caused by the fact that  
> > 9.3cm is more than half the region-body width, which is 8.26in (auto  
> > width) minus 1.4in (margins).
> > If you reduce 'left' to roughly 8.7cm, it will more closely match the  
> > intended outcome, if I interpret correctly: the line is meant as a  
> > visual column-separator (?)
> > 
> > For the second block, I'm not sure what has changed that previously  
> > hid the line behind blocks with span='all'. In theory, this would  
> > require using the z-index property, but AFAIK, FOP does not yet take  
> > that into account when painting the areas.
